A Good Talker, Passive Listener, or an Active Listener

All recruiters talk well. They need to, as they have to communicate effectively to get their point across, to their clients, as well as, their candidates. There are a few critical elements in this regards that you have to be aware of, when it comes to executive recruitment agencies. These critical elements center on talking and listening.

A Good Talker or a Sweet Talker

There is a thin line of demarcation between somebody who talks well and somebody who sweetens the talk. The words coming out of recruiter’s mouth should be pertinent to the topic A good talker in a positive sense means somebody who is only talking sense and whatever is coming out of his mouth is actually working constructively towards fomenting your relationship with the recruiter. On the other side of the fence, you have the sweet talker. Somebody, who really wants you onboard as a client; he or she will give a whole list of accomplishments about his/her work and how they will almost guarantee a well-paying position with a top company! The keyword here is a sweet talking recruiter will ‘Almost’ do everything he or she is saying.

A Passive Listener

Talking is important but so is listening. A recruiter, who is just going on and on and not trying to listen to what a candidate has to say, is just that – A Big Talker. What you want is somebody who is a Good Listener. Even here, you don’t want a passive listener. You need somebody who listens attentively and shows that he/she is interested in what you are saying. A passive listener will not give you the right impression and the attitude might be symptomatic of his skills and the kind of attention he will offer your candidature. Words must go into the ears of a recruiter and not just bounce off the entrance. If you are talking to a passive listener, you might just take it as a potential sign of the disregard that is to come with regards to your working relationship with the recruiter.

An Active Listener

This is one of the better sorts of recruiters. An active listener is somebody who interacts in a constructive manner with the candidate. He talks, and he listens and what’s more, he listens actively. What this essentially means is that there is a conversation and a process of dialogue between you and the recruiter. You don’t feel shortchanged as far as the conversation goes. It’s not a one way street.

Connection is Important

The whole point about talking or listening with reference to a recruiter and a candidate is that you need to be able to establish a connection with the executive recruitment agencies and vice versa. You need to be able to open up with the person who is actually going to try and get you a job. Your desires, hopes, and ambitions must be clear. This would help him/her to shortlist a few opening or possible opening that will suit your needs and requirements. This will help you land a great job.
